SpaceX’s Starship blows up ahead of 10th test flight


One of the launch vehicles of SpaceX Starship exploded on a test stand in Texas on Wednesday evening, while the company was preparing for the tenth trial flight of the heavy rocket system.

SpaceX said that “all the staff is safe and taken into account” A post on xAnd said there was “no danger to residents of the surrounding communities”. The company has not provided an explanation for the explosion.

It is not immediately clear what impact it will have on spacex development of the Starship rocket system. A recent advisory From the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) suggested that the tenth test flight could have occurred on June 29.

The CEO of SpaceX, Elon Musk, said in an apparently linked post To the explosion he considers it: “Just a scratch.”

SpaceX has spent the last years aggressively developing the 171 feet starship and the 232 feet of 232 feet of 232 heavy feet which feeds it in space. The company started 2025 adage This year would be a “transformation” for the program, and the FAA recently increased its limit to the launches of starship in Texas from 5 to 25.

But Starship, in particular, has had a number of problems this year. The rocket unexpectedly exploded during its seventh test flight in Januaryand then Still in March. He failed again during his Ninth test in May.

While the rocket came to his last flight in May that during the previous two tests, he still failed to deploy the silent starlink satellites he was carrying – a crucial step in the company’s plan to use the mega -rocking to develop its space internet service.

Musk argued that SpaceX is on the right track to try to send a ship to March in 2026, which gives it a chance “50/50” In an update of the company in May. The company also develops a larger “version 3” of Starship which, according to Musk, could fly this year.
